s = "PYTHON" >>> while s != "" : for c in s : print(c, end="") s = s[:-1]
时间: 2023-12-05 17:19:42 浏览: 10
这段代码会输出字符串 "PYTHON" 的每个字符,每次输出一个,然后将字符串的最后一个字符去掉,直到字符串为空,循环结束。
例如,第一次循环输出 "PYTHON" 的第一个字符 "P",然后将字符串变为 "PYTHO"。第二次循环输出 "Y",然后将字符串变为 "PYTH"。以此类推,直到循环结束。最终输出结果为:
PYTHONYTHOPYTOPYPYP
相关问题
s = "PYTHON" while s !="": for c in s: if c == "T": break print(c,end="") s=s[:-1]
这段代码的输出结果是: "PYTHO"。
代码的解释如下:
首先,将字符串 s 赋值为 "PYTHON"。
然后,进入一个 while 循环,条件为 s 不为空字符串。
在 while 循环内部,使用 for 循环遍历字符串 s 中的每个字符。对于每个字符,如果它等于 "T",则使用 break 语句跳出 for 循环。
如果字符不等于 "T",则将其打印出来(使用 end="" 使得打印出来的字符不换行)。
接着,使用 s = s[:-1] 将字符串 s 的最后一个字符删除掉。这样,下一次循环时,就会遍历一个更短的字符串。
当字符串 s 变成空字符串时,while 循环停止。此时,程序输出的就是 "PYTHO"。
i=5 while i>=1: num=1 for j in range(1,i+1): print(num,end="xxx") num*=2 print() i-=1
好的,我明白了,我可以与您进行对话并且我与 OpenAI公司开发的ChatGPT没有关系。关于您的问题,这是一个 Python 中的循环结构,用于生成一组数字。下面是代码的解释:
首先,定义变量 i 的初始值为 5。然后,在 while 循环内部,使用 num 变量来存储最初为 1 的数字。在内部的 for 循环中,变量 j 从 1 开始,从而生成 j - 1 个 xxx 字符串。每次循环,数字 num 被乘以 2,以便生成下一个数字。在每次执行内部的 for 循环后,程序使用 print() 函数打印一行。最后,变量 i 被减 1,直到最后 i 的值不到 1,程序结束。
希望这能回答您的问题。如果您有其他问题,请随时问我。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)